Omaha vs Texas Holdem: Whatâs the Difference?

This article will briefly explore the key differences between Texas Holdâem and Omaha, focusing on aspects such as hole cards, pros and cons, and overall gameplay.
Identical Features
- Hand rankings
- Blinds
- Positions
- Betting actions
- Betting rounds
- Community cards

Different Features
| Aspect | Texas Hold’em | Omaha |
|---|---|---|
| Hole Cards | 2 | 4 |
| Gameplay | Players use 2 hole cards in combination with the community cards to create the best possible five-card hand. | Players must use exactly 2 of their 4 hole cards in combination with 3 of the 5 community cards to make the best hand. |
| Dynamics | Slow | Fast |
| Pot Sizes | Smaller | Bigger |

What is the core difference between Texas Holdem and Omaha?
What is the core difference between Texas Hold’em and Omaha? The best difference is the number of hole cards dealt: Texas Hold’em gives each player two, while Omaha gives each player four.
What is the meaning of TPTK in poker?
In Texas Hold’em poker, TPTK stands for “Top Pair, Top Kicker.” When one of your hands can form a pair with the highest card in the community cards, this is a “top pair.” If the other card is an Ace, the highest-ranking card,it becomes the “top kicker.” Together, this is known as TPTK (Top Pair Top Kicker). For example, if your hand is Ace-J and the flop is 5-J-3, you have top pair (Js) with a top kicker (Ace), making your hand “TPTK”
